Who is Dan Castellaneta?

Dan Castellaneta is an American actor, voice actor, comedian, and screenwriter who has a net worth of $85 million. Born on October 29, 1957, in Chicago, Illinois, Castellaneta developed his passion for performing arts early in life. He attended Oak Park and River Forest High School before studying art education at Northern Illinois University. However, his true calling was in entertainment, and he soon found himself drawn to the world of comedy and voice work.

Castellaneta's career took off when he joined The Second City, Chicago's legendary improvisational comedy troupe, where he honed his skills alongside other comedy greats. His breakthrough came when he was cast as the voice of Homer Simpson in the animated series "The Simpsons," which premiered in 1989 and has since become the longest-running American sitcom and animated program.

What is Dan Castellaneta's Net Worth and Salary?

When examining Dan Castellaneta's financial success, we need to look beyond just the numbers and understand the magnitude of his achievement. His $85 million net worth represents decades of consistent work in one of television's most successful franchises. But how did he accumulate such wealth, and what does it mean in the context of voice acting careers?

Castellaneta's salary from "The Simpsons" has been a subject of much speculation over the years. In the early seasons, voice actors were paid modest amounts for their work. However, as the show's popularity exploded, so did the cast's compensation. At one point, Castellaneta and his fellow main voice actors were earning approximately $300,000 per episode. With around 22 episodes per season, this translated to roughly $6.6 million per year from the show alone.

A Look into Dan Castellaneta's Net Worth, Money, and Current Earnings

Understanding Castellaneta's financial journey requires examining the various revenue streams that contribute to his impressive net worth. His earnings from "The Simpsons" form the foundation, but they represent just one piece of a much larger financial puzzle. Over the show's 30+ year run, Castellaneta has voiced not only Homer Simpson but also numerous other characters, including Grampa Simpson, Barney Gumble, Krusty the Clown, Groundskeeper Willie, Mayor Quimby, and Sideshow Mel.

The syndication deals for "The Simpsons" have been particularly lucrative. As the voice of the show's main character, Castellaneta likely receives residuals from reruns, streaming platforms, and international broadcasts. These passive income streams continue to generate revenue long after the initial recording sessions, creating a financial foundation that grows over time.

Beyond his Simpsons earnings, Castellaneta has appeared in various other television shows, films, and voice acting projects. He's lent his voice to video games, commercials, and other animated series. Additionally, he's written and produced content, further diversifying his income sources. His work in theater and live performances, though perhaps less lucrative than his television work, has contributed to his overall financial portfolio.
